The U.S. Federal Reserve's latest Beige Book points to a new kind of scarcity taking hold across the economy, as the race to build out artificial-intelligence infrastructure squeezes both traditional trades and emerging roles. According to a July 16 Axios report built on the Beige Book released July 15, data-center construction and related capital spending are creating bottlenecks in labor and raw materials that businesses are now reporting from multiple Fed districts.
